Configuración del protocolo modbus, 10 respuestas de excepción – KROHNE ALTOSONIC V12 ES Manual del usuario

Página 124

Advertising
background image

10

CONFIGURACIÓN DEL PROTOCOLO MODBUS

124

ALTOSONIC V12

www.krohne.com

08/2013 - 4002644101- MA ALTOSONIC V12 R02 es

Solicitud

El mensaje de solicitud especifica las referencias de registro que se deben preajustar. Los
registros se direccionan empezando por cero (el registro 1 se direcciona como 0).

Ejemplo

Ejemplo de solicitud para que el equipo esclavo 17 preajuste dos registros empezando por 40002
(decimal), 9C42 (hexadecimal) hasta 00 0A y 01 02 hex:

Respuesta

La respuesta normal devuelve la dirección del esclavo, el código de función, la dirección de inicio
y la cantidad de registros preajustados:

Si la solicitud no es aplicable, se enviará una respuesta de excepción.
Para más información, vaya a

Respuestas de excepción

en la página 124.

10.5.10 Respuestas de excepción

Salvo en el caso de los mensajes de difusión, un equipo maestro espera recibir una respuesta
normal cuando envía una solicitud a un equipo esclavo. Cuando el equipo maestro envía su
solicitud, puede pasar alguna de las siguientes cuatro cosas:

• Si el equipo esclavo recibe la solicitud sin ningún error de comunicación y puede procesarla

con normalidad, envía una respuesta normal.

• Si el esclavo no recibe la solicitud debido a un error de comunicación, no envía ninguna

respuesta. Finalmente, el programa maestro procesará una condición de tiempo límite para
la solicitud.

• Si el esclavo recibe la solicitud pero detecta un error de comunicación (paridad, CRC, LRC),

no envía ninguna respuesta. Si el esclavo no recibe la solicitud debido a un error de
comunicación, no envía ninguna respuesta.

Cabece
ra

direcci
ón
esclav
o

Funció
n

Dirección
de inicio

Cantidad

Recue
ntos de
bytes

Datos

Compr
obació
n de
errore
s/cola

-

11(h)

10(h)

Hi

9C(h)

Low

41(h)

Hi

00(h)

Low

02(h)

04(h)

Hi

00(h)

Low

0A(h)

Hi

01(h)

Low

02(h)

- / -

Tabla 10-7: Ejemplo de múltiples registros de retención

Cabecera

dirección
esclavo

Función

Dirección
de inicio

Cantidad
de puntos

Comproba
ción de
errores

Cola

--

11(h)

10(h)

Hi

9C(h)

Low

41(h)

Hi

00(h)

Low

02(h)

--

--

Tabla 10-8: Respuesta de múltiples registros de retención

Advertising